Hi, hang in there :)

How about ..

S - Having identified the need, find out where the course is being offered and sign up ..
M - Level/qualification you gain & expected attendance.
A - is it? have you enrolled on a course that you've been told is suitable and appropriate for your needs/purpose, do you have the time and physical resources available to comit to what's involved.
R yes - you are capable & have support:) - funding has the potential to break this ..
T yes & possibly - what is the duration of the course and does the qualification have an expiry date attached.

I chose children's behaviour as my area of development. Why? to learn more and understand better children's behaviour and how to deal with it effectively and positively. I said that I would look for avaliable courses in the area and observe and learn from more experienced members of staff. I would discuss with the manager the dates, when I would be expected to complete the course.
